Work History

Superintendent

Woodland School
01.2022 - Current
  • Leadership & Administration: Provide strategic direction and oversight for a 220 K-8 public charter school district, increasing the fund balance from 24 to 35% from 202-2025
  • Increased student enrollment by 10% and have maintained it, while hiring several key staff during tenure
  • Board & Governance: Work closely with the Board of Directors, supporting policy development, strategic initiatives, and school improvement planning
  • Led efforts to recruit five new board members for 2022-2025
  • Strategic Planning: Created a school/parent strategic planning committee, leading yearly updates to the Woodland School mission and vision
  • This committee, composed of parents, board members, and staff, focuses on curriculum, staffing, school vision, and building needs
  • Curriculum & Instruction: Led the implementation of the science of reading UFLI and Fishtank reading programs, enhancing literacy outcomes, and integrated a new K-5 math curriculum, implemented schoolwide VR classroom headset curriculum
  • Assessment & Data-Driven Decisions: Championed the use of NWEA MAP, STAR literacy, and math assessments to track student progress and inform instructional strategies
  • Developed child study processes and added math and reading interventionists at all grade levels
  • PBIS & Student Supports: Established a tiered PBIS system and implemented a school-wide SEL program through Move This World
  • Created Woodland's first guidance counselor position and successfully filled the role
  • Community Engagement: Organized events like Literacy Night and Winterfest, strengthening relationships with families, local businesses, and stakeholders
  • Established multiple community partnerships, including Father Fred, TCAPS sports and high school transition programs, and musical collaborations with Central High School's theater, band, and choir programs
  • Building Renovations & Upgrades: Led major facility improvements, including: $100,000 theater lighting replacement, $125,000 roof replacement, Flooring and carpet upgrades, furniture upgrades, and extensive renovations, Created a Head of Maintenance/Facilities Director position to oversee ongoing projects
  • Arts & Music Partnerships: Developed relationships with Marshall Music, Blue Lake Fine Arts Camp, Northwest Ballet Academy, and Dance Arts Academy, enriching student experiences with live performances, workshops, and camp opportunities
  • Technology & Innovation: Integrated iPads and Chromebooks into classrooms to support a 1:1 digital learning initiative
  • Upgraded PA systems and security infrastructure, including district-wide emergency planning and camera systems
  • School Safety & Security: Implemented major security upgrades, including: Exterior lighting poles in parking lots, Upgraded light poles along sidewalks and building lighting, New camera and security systems using grants, Established partnerships with Grand Traverse County Sheriff Department, White Water Township Fire Department, and Michigan State Troopers for school-wide safety initiatives
